Releases: narrowlink/narrowlink
Releases · narrowlink/narrowlink
0.2.6
Commits
- 52ac50a: Fix memory leak and improper tcp shutdown in the TUN interface (#99)
- f233b6c: Integrate chunkio (#100)
- 890eaaf: Update h2 to fix continuation-flood (#101)
- 48d2c8e: Bump rustls from 0.21.10 to 0.21.11 (#103)
- 72123bb: Kyber Bugfix #113 [Webserver Publish] - TLS doesn't work on latest Chromium (& Chromium-based) browsers (#114)
0.2.5
What's Changed
- Enhanced stability of the tun interface narrowlink/ipstack#25 narrowlink/ipstack#23
- Implemented performance enhancements 9a6658c
- Resolved a potential Use-After-Free (UAF) vulnerability 9a6658c https://rustsec.org/advisories/RUSTSEC-2024-0019.html
0.2.4
0.2.3
0.2.2
0.2.1
0.2.0
Major Changes
- Implemented direct peer-to-peer connectivity between clients and agents using QUIC protocol. Tunnels now can use both relay and direct modes.
- Added experimental TUN interface support to receive IP traffic. (Requires privileged access).
- Replaced single certificate for all domains with individual certificates for each domain to improve privacy.
- Simplified access control by only sending rules when command channel connects rather than each connection.
Other Enhancements
- Agents can now run in background
- Reduced binary size
- Improved logging
- Enhanced stability
- Better error handling
Known Issues
- TUN interface requires privileged access and is currently experimental. Guidelines will be provided for safe usage.
- Breaking changes from 0.1.x releases. Not backwards compatible.
Read more: https://narrowlink.com/blog/Narrowlink-0.2.0-Peer-to-Peer-Connectivity-and-TUN-Interface
0.1.4
0.1.3
- Add x86_64-unknown-freebsd
- Error handling improvement
- Fixing the partial transfer issue
- Internal improvements
Narrowlink first release - 0.1.2
add 'emplates/*.html' to Cargo.toml include config